[04.07.22] News-ENPOR at the 3rd International Conference on Energy Research and Social Science, University of Manchester

ENPOR’s team organized a session on 22 June 2022: “Energy poverty in the European private rented sector: Findings from the ENPOR project” with five presentations followed with a fruitful discussion.

  • Understanding the current European policy landscape addressing energy poverty in the Private Rented Sector (Dimitris Papantonis)
  • Structural factors impacting energy efficiency policy implementation in the European Private Rented Sector (Dimitris Papantonis)
  • Indicators to measure energy poverty in the European Private Rented Sector (Florin Vondung)
  • Visualising energy poverty in the European private rented sector: The Energy Poverty Dashboard (Manon Burbidge)
  • Co-design process for the adaptation of policies to combat energy poverty in the Private Rented Sector (Christos Tourkolias)

Chair: Harriet Thomson
